Buckle Up, Buttercup: What to Expect on the Big Day
The Georgia road skills test is your chance to show the examiner you're not a real-life bumper car waiting to happen. You'll be cruising the actual streets, not some miniature putt-putt course for automobiles. Here's a sneak peek of what's on the menu:

Parallel Parking Party: Remember Tetris? This is like Tetris, but with a much bigger chance of bumping into something and making a bunch of angry beeping noises. Don't worry, they won't judge your taste in music (unless "Macarena" is blasting at full volume).
The Straight Line Back-Up Boogie: Channel your inner reverse gear rockstar and navigate a straight line in reverse for 50 feet. Think of it as your own personal moonwalk, minus the moon and the questionable dance moves.
Following the Leader (the Responsible Kind): This isn't kindergarten playtime. You'll be following another car while maintaining a safe distance, because nobody likes a tailgater (except maybe those pesky pigeons).
Yielding is Believing: This isn't a fortune cookie message, it's crucial! Be prepared to yield to pedestrians and other vehicles when necessary. Remember, sharing is caring, even on the road.
